Jordan Named iHeartCountry Brand Coordinator

• iHeartCountry announced that Michael Jordan, Regional Senior Vice President of Programming for iHeartMedia’s Kentucky-Indiana Region, has been named Brand Coordinator for iHeartCountry, effective immediately. Within this newly created role, Jordan will report to Rod Phillips, Executive Vice President of Programming for iHeartCountry and be responsible for overseeing the growth, roll-out and execution for all local and live Country music-based events for iHeartMedia’s Country stations. Jordan will continue his role as Regional Senior Vice President of Programming for iHeartMedia’s Kentucky-Indiana Region.

Jordan is a 16-year iHeartMedia veteran who previously held several senior positions in Lexington and Louisville, including SVP of Programming, Program Director of WAMZ/Louisville and WBUL (98.1 The Bull)/Lexington, KY, and Director of NTR and Promotions for iHeartMedia Lexington. Jordan began his radio oddyessy at the impressionable age of 12 at the former WTKT-FM (Oldies 103.3)/Lexington, KY.

Community involvement has always been an integral part of Jordan’s personal and professional life, through his philanthropic efforts with organizations like the University of Kentucky Children’s Hospital, University of Kentucky Barnstable-Brown, Diabetes Center and Lexington Cancer Foundation.
